  • 1. TAKE Sushi

    How do you get the correct order at TAKE, a Japanese restaurant in Bali with a 2000+ menu? Easy, because there is no such thing as the wrong order here. Pick the Otoro Aburi or Black Tiger Roll, and get ready for an authentic Japanese bite. Say bye to California Rolls and order the Black Roe and Iidako Sushi (it’s baby octopus, by the way) instead. Expect the scallops or Hokki clams from the Sashimi menu to burst with oceanic flavors.

    Source: @takejapanesebali

    TAKE not only delivers the best sushi in Seminyak, but the open kitchen, tatami, and Japanese knickknacks also bring the A-game to other Japanese faves. Not a fan of raw fish? They also have ramen, cold and hot noodles, donburi, and live seafood (lobster, anyone?) on the 44-page menu!

  • 2. Sushimi Bali

    Feast your eyes and tummy with a sushi train starting from 20K! The sushi ranges from tempura prawn and tonkatsu pork sushi rolls to Aburi kingfish and Tamago nigiri, which will make it hard for you to stop eating the plate. And when the tuna rolls paired with Balinese sambal matah and vegan Cheeken Teriyaki pass through you, can you say no?

    Source: @sushimibali

    As the only sushi restaurant in Seminyak with the train concept, Sushimi goes beyond raw fish and rolled vinegared rice. The crab claws and Takoyaki make a perfect side bite. At the same time, Kimchi Udon and Salmon Teriyaki give you options outside the outrageously tasty sushi donuts, burritos, and finger rolls.

  • 3. Ryoshi Sushi House of Jazz

    Jazz and sushi seem like an odd pair, only if you’ve never visited Ryoshi Sushi House of Jazz. While your chopsticks pick the grilled eel, Ikura salmon caviar, or raw butterfish, let the melody from the saxophones lend a dramatic vibe to your dinner. The creamy and chewy Salmon Avocado Maki or the crunch of Spicy Tuna Rolls amps up the heat to your already soulful evening.

    Source: @ryoshibali

    Ryoshi reserves the rich Nabeyaki Udon and Kitsune Soba broth for non-sushi aficionados. If you are famished, we suggest the Ryoshi Special Set, which comes with two main courses, five appetizers, rice, soup, and green tea. Ryoshi knows everyone comes here for the jazz, so clear your Monday and Friday nights to visit this legendary restaurant in Seminyak.

  • 4. Aburi Sushi

    Take your time going over the jam-packed menu at one of the best sushi places in Seminyak. The Sushi Paradise at Aburi Sushi lists everything that falls under the sun in the sushi world. If you love the heat, the spicy Inari Lava Bomb and Aburi Tuna Lava will satisfy your taste buds. You don’t have to mull over the a la carte menu because The Sushi Moriawase package brings sushi, sashimi, maki, and gunkan on one plate.

    Source: @aburisushi_bali

    You will never regret splurging on the premium taste of Aburi Hotate Foie Gras and Aburi Toro Ikura. While the sushi menu list at this Japanese restaurant in Seminyak seems endless, Aburi’s excellence extends beyond the sushi rolls, inari, and temaki. Ebi Tempura Tamago Toji represents the Donburi menu, and the soba, udon, and ramen show why you should put Aburi on your must-visit Japanese place to eat in Seminyak.

  • 5. Kajin Sushi Bar

    Are you in need of an intimate sushi restaurant in Seminyak? The only correct answer is Kajin. While the thinly sliced salmon or Hamachi makes an excellent entrée, the Smoked Salmon Cream Cheese Roll will blow your mind. We’ve got no note for the sublime combo of smoked salmon and cream cheese. If the Sashimi Set couldn’t give you a sushi coma, what’s the point of coming to Kajin?

    Source: @kajinbali

    Kajin's fantastic sake and cocktails lineup puts any other bars in Seminyak to shame. Ask the server for the perfect sake suggestions if the names Nigori, Honjozo, and Junmai sound foreign. The signature cocktail never misses the Japanese touch. Wasabi Cucumber Gimlet infuses Japanese cucumber and wasabi, while yuzu lends the sour note in Kagoshima Sour.

  • 6. Art of Sushi

    Art of Sushi may only do takeaway and delivery, but they have a huge menu! They know nothing beats the comfort of enjoying the Art Roll or Philadelphia Tuna Roll from your couch. Order the Maki, States, or Art Set if you host a party because everyone will devour the rolls, maki, and nigiri in no time.

    Source: @artofsushi

    If you go for the Fried Roll, whether it’s the prawn, butterfish, or salmon, your order comes with avocado salsa, Tobiko Black, and sauce Tonkatsu. The gunkan and sashimi make a perfect addition to the sushi, but the non-sushi menu deserves mention. Go for the smoky Wok menu, with egg or rice noodles with chicken, pork, prawn, beef, or vegetables.

  • 7. Dahana Restaurant

    Dahana embodies sushi restaurants in the way it deserves to be enjoyed in Seminyak. You'll never look back once you take a bite of the butterfish and tuna in Negitoro Maki or the crunch of prawn tempura in Ebi Tempura Roll. Take your friends or family for a Japanese-themed dinner because the Sushi Sashimi Set, especially Casablanca, comes with 32 pieces of tuna, salmon, gindara, snapper, tamago, and futomaki roll!

    Source: @dahanabali

    The design of Dahana resembles a Japanese garden, complete with a lotus pond, so you instantly get the Zen vibe. Junmai sake will definitely complete your Japanese dinner. But feel free to pick Wabi Sabi Margarita from the cocktail menu as well. The blend of tequila, sake, and wasabi paste served with nori sheet and wakame dust leaves perfect notes of spice and bitterness, but it is oh so addictive!

  • 8. Pine Restaurant and Sushi Seminyak

    When you don’t know where to eat sushi in Seminyak, why not try a hidden gem like Pine Restaurant? The deep-fried Banzai Roll sushi may be far from healthy, but it’s hard to resist the smooth and creamy salmon with cream cheese combo. You can also stick to the classic Rainbow Roll, where fresh salmon, bluefin tuna, eel, and shrimp create an eclectic flavor explosion when you bite.

    Source: @pine.bali

    While we can talk non-stop about the sushi rolls, nigiri, and maki, the rice bowl is another slam dunk hit at Pine. We tell everyone to try the Shrimp Furai and Egg Don, and Sashimi and Ikura Don are two Donburi menus. They often have an 85K deal where you can have chicken katsu, rice, miso soup, green tea, and edamame.
